Consider the photograph. The taller man's condition is due to a malfunction in the pituitary gland, which secretes growth hormon

e. Damage to which part of the brain may be indicated by this condition?

The taller man's condition which is due to a malfunction in the pituitary gland is called Gigantism. This condition is due to the malfunction in the pituitary gland, which secretes too much growth hormone, which is known as somatotropin. This condition is usually because of a tumor in the gland. The pituitary gland is a pea-sized structure which is located at the base of the brain.

What is the relationship between allele frequency's and a gene pool.
GenaCL600 [577]
Allele frequency refers to how common an allele is in a population. It is determined by counting how many times the allele appears in the population then dividing by the total number of copies of the gene. The gene pool of a population consists of all the copies of all the genes in that population.

Explain complementary base pairing. which are purines and pyrimidines and who bonds to whom? how many hydrogen bonds form betwee
Marat540 [252]
Each nitrogenous base has one counterpart. The purines are adenine and guanine and they pair with the pyrimidines thymine and cytosine, respectively. There are two hydrogen bonds between adenine and thymine and three hydrogen bonds between guanine and cytosine.

Define (Chlorophyll)<br> Thank you!
larisa [96]

Answer:

a green pigment, present in all green plants and in cyanobacteria, responsible for the absorption of light to provide energy for photosynthesis. Its molecule contains a magnesium atom held in a porphyrin ring.

The anterior and posterior lobes of the pituitary differ in that _____.
xenn [34]

Answer:

-The posterior pituitary does not secrete its hormones but acts as an extension of the hypothalamus, storing those hormones.

-The anterior pituitary secretes its hormones (predominantly tropic hormones).
